Is Bothell, WA a Good Place to Live?

Bothell receives an overall livability grade of B+ (75/100), placing it among the better areas in Washington. Safety scores A (84/100), indicating lower crime rates than most areas. Affordability scores A (80/100) with a median household income of $139,928 and median home values around $795,000.

About 56.9% of residents hold a bachelor's degree or higher, and the unemployment rate is 3.9%. 68% of housing is owner-occupied. The median age is 37.
